Reasons for Removing the Coolant Overflow Tank

There are several reasons why you may need to remove the coolant overflow tank. One of the most common reasons is to replace the tank itself, which may be damaged or leaking. Other reasons may include inspecting or replacing the coolant level sensor, cleaning or replacing the tank’s hoses, or accessing other components in the cooling system. Additionally, if you are experiencing issues with your vehicle’s cooling system, such as overheating or coolant leaks, removing the overflow tank may be necessary to diagnose and repair the problem.

Some common symptoms that may indicate the need to remove the coolant overflow tank include:

  • Coolant leaks or spills
  • Overheating engine
  • Low coolant level
  • Coolant level sensor malfunction
  • Corrosion or damage to the tank or its components

Preparation and Safety Precautions

Draining the Cooling System

Before removing the coolant overflow tank, it is essential to drain the cooling system to prevent spills and messes. This can be done by locating the drain valve or petcock on the radiator and turning it counterclockwise to open. Allow the coolant to drain into a pan or container, taking care not to spill any on the ground or surrounding surfaces.

It is also crucial to wear protective gloves and eyewear when working with coolant, as it can cause skin and eye irritation. Additionally, make sure the vehicle is parked on a level surface and apply the parking brake to prevent any accidental movement.

Disconnecting the Battery and Other Components

To prevent any accidental starts or electrical shocks, it is recommended to disconnect the battery and other components that may be connected to the cooling system. This may include the coolant level sensor, thermostat, or other electrical components.

Use a wrench or socket to loosen the battery terminals, and then remove the negative (black) cable from the battery post. This will help prevent any electrical shocks or shorts during the removal process.

Removing the Tank’s Mounting Brackets and Hoses

Once the cooling system has been drained and the battery and other components have been disconnected, you can begin removing the tank’s mounting brackets and hoses. Use a socket or wrench to loosen the brackets, and then pull the tank away from the engine block or other surrounding components.

Be careful not to damage any of the hoses or other components during the removal process, as this can cause leaks or other issues with the cooling system. If the tank is stuck or rusted in place, use a gentle rocking motion to loosen it, taking care not to apply too much force.

Removing the Coolant Overflow Tank: The Removal Process

Now that you’ve prepared yourself and your vehicle, it’s time to remove the coolant overflow tank. This section will walk you through the step-by-step removal process.

Removing the Tank Mounting Bolts

Locate the tank mounting bolts, which are usually located on the side or bottom of the tank. Use a ratchet and socket set to loosen the bolts in a star pattern to avoid stripping the threads.

Once the bolts are loose, use a wrench or pliers to remove them completely. Be careful not to damage the surrounding components or hoses.

Disconnecting the Tank from the Engine or Components

With the tank mounting bolts removed, you can now disconnect the tank from the engine or nearby components. This may involve removing additional clips or hoses.

Use a Torx screwdriver (if applicable) to loosen any screws or clips holding the tank in place. Gently pull the tank away from the engine or components to avoid damaging any surrounding components or hoses.

Removing the Tank from the Vehicle

Once the tank is disconnected from the engine or components, you can now remove it from the vehicle. Carefully lift the tank out of the engine compartment, taking note of any nearby components or hoses that may be affected by the removal process.

Place the tank in a safe location, such as a workbench or a designated area for disposal, to prevent any accidental damage or spills.
